Welcome to the Pinfold, Blind Lane, Waddington!! A true blend of character, move in ready accommodation, space in abundance all of which positioned on a stunning plot in the heart of Waddington village.
A unique traditionally built honey coloured stone and pantile four bedroom property in the centre of the popular village of Waddington. The property is part of an enclave of “old world” buildings that give this part of the village it’s distinctive character. The property sits on a circa ¼ acre plot (subject to survey) and has views to the horizon over the Trent Valley. Originally part of a small holding, the property was extensively remodelled in the 1970’s and been extensively modernised by the current owner occupiers over the last 18 years. The property has a blend of original antique, vintage and modern features. The property is surrounded by traditional stone walls giving unrestricted access all round the buildings.
Accommodation in this simply flawless home comprises; Entrance Hall, WC, Utility Room, Breakfast Kitchen, Dining Room, Expansive Lounge with a Log Burner, Four Double Bedrooms, Family Bathroom and Shower Room. Externally the property offers more than ample off street parking, a well sized double garage and a flawlessly landscaped and well sized rear garden.
Blind Lane is a quiet side street within Waddington. There is easy access to the local shops, doctors, bus routes and school. The Viking Way passes very close by.
An ideal quiet family home with potential to extend the property significantly and sub-divide the plot subject to the relevant planning permissions.
